The actual original Polar Special goes for about 1 hour and ten minutes. What we were shown went for around 50 minutes. In the original, they went on to talk about rocking the car back and forth to get out of being bogged, as well as talking about running the tyres as low as 2 psi over the really soft snow where they got bogged and rocking didn't work. They then went on to talk about the onboard compressor in the back to re-inflate the tyres. In the training part they talk to a guy about frostbite, and he shows them pictures of a guy with frostbite on his wedding vegetables. We did actually miss quite a bit of the show. As for the emergency hammer, it simply kept falling off, and the BBC are adament that it was the one Hilux these guys used.
